Vista Oil Gas Company Revenue Analysis
Vista Oil's Revenue is income that a firm generates from business activities such us rendering services or selling goods to customers. It is a crucial part of a business and an essential item when evaluating a company's financial statements. Revenues from a firm's primary business operations can be reported on the income statement as sales revenue, net sales, or simply sales, depending on the industry in which a given company operates.

Based on the latest financial disclosure, Vista Oil Gas reported 1.17 B of revenue. This is 97.62% lower than that of the Oil, Gas & Consumable Fuels sector and 64.46% lower than that of the Energy industry. The revenue for all United States stocks is 87.61% higher than that of the company.

Vista Oil Institutional Holders
Institutional Holdings refers to the ownership stake in Vista Oil that is held by large financial organizations, pension funds or endowments. Institutions may purchase large blocks of Vista Oil's outstanding shares and can exert considerable influence upon its management. Institutional holders may also work to push the share price higher once they own the stock. The market value of Vista Oil Gas is measured differently than its book value, which is the value of Vista that is recorded on the company's balance sheet. Investors also form their own opinion of Vista Oil's value that differs from its market value or its book value, called intrinsic value, which is Vista Oil's true underlying value. Investors use various methods to calculate intrinsic value and buy a stock when its market value falls below its intrinsic value. Because Vista Oil's market value can be influenced by many factors that don't directly affect Vista Oil's underlying business (such as a pandemic or basic market pessimism), market value can vary widely from intrinsic value.
Please note, there is a significant difference between Vista Oil's value and its price as these two are different measures arrived at by different means. Investors typically determine if Vista Oil is a good investment by looking at such factors as earnings, sales, fundamental and technical indicators, competition as well as analyst projections. However, Vista Oil's price is the amount at which it trades on the open market and represents the number that a seller and buyer find agreeable to each party.
